What Qualifies as a Neutral Carpet Color?
The best neutral carpet colors are those that provide a versatile and adaptable base for various interior design styles.
- Beige: Beige is a warm, earthy tone that creates a cozy atmosphere while complementing a wide array of colors and patterns in decor. It is particularly effective in living spaces and bedrooms, as it offers a soft background that does not overwhelm the senses.
- Gray: Gray is a modern neutral that ranges from light to dark shades, making it suitable for both contemporary and traditional settings. Its cool undertones can add sophistication to a room and pair well with bolder accent colors, allowing for a stylish yet calming environment.
- Taupe: Taupe is a blend of gray and brown, providing a rich, warm neutral that works beautifully in various styles, from rustic to elegant. This color can add depth to a space and is particularly effective in creating an inviting and warm ambiance.
- Ivory: Ivory is a soft, off-white color that brings lightness and airiness to a room. It is ideal for smaller spaces or areas where natural light is limited, as it reflects light and can make a room feel larger and more open.
- Greige: Greige, a combination of gray and beige, has gained popularity for its versatility and ability to bridge the gap between warm and cool tones. This color is perfect for modern homes that wish to maintain a neutral palette while adding a touch of warmth and depth.

What Factors Should You Consider When Selecting a Neutral Carpet Color?
When selecting the best neutral carpet color, several factors should be considered to ensure it complements your space effectively.
- Room Size: The size of the room can significantly influence the perception of color. In smaller spaces, lighter neutral colors can make the area feel more open and airy, while darker shades can create a cozy, intimate atmosphere.
- Lighting Conditions: The amount and type of natural light your room receives can alter how carpet colors appear. Warm lighting can enhance beige and taupe tones, while cooler lighting may make grays and whites look more prominent, so it’s essential to observe the carpet in different lighting scenarios.
- Existing Decor: Consider the color palette of your existing furniture, walls, and accessories. A neutral carpet should harmonize with these elements, serving as a unifying backdrop that enhances rather than competes with your decor.
- Maintenance and Durability: Different neutral colors can show dirt and stains differently. Lighter shades may require more frequent cleaning, while darker options can hide imperfections better, making them a practical choice for high-traffic areas or homes with pets.
- Personal Style: Your aesthetic preference plays a crucial role in selecting a carpet color. Whether you prefer a classic look with beiges and creams or a modern vibe with grays and taupes, the chosen neutral should reflect your style while still offering versatility to adapt to future changes in decor.
- Trends vs. Timelessness: While trendy colors may seem appealing, opting for a timeless neutral can provide longevity in style. Neutral tones like gray, beige, and taupe are often considered safe choices that can withstand changing design trends, ensuring your carpet remains fashionable for years to come.
How Can Room Size Affect Your Choice of Neutral Carpet?
When selecting a neutral carpet color, room size plays a crucial role in achieving the desired aesthetic and functionality. Larger rooms often provide more flexibility with color choices, allowing for richer hues or darker neutrals that can anchor the space. Examples include:
- Greys and taupes: These colors can define space without overwhelming it, providing a modern yet inviting backdrop.
- Beiges and soft browns: These warmer tones can create a cozy atmosphere, making expansive areas feel more intimate.
In smaller rooms, lighter neutral colors are generally more suitable. They reflect light, making the space appear larger and more open. Options include:
- Light creams and soft whites: These shades can enhance brightness, making a compact area feel airy and spacious.
- Pale greys: This color can add depth while keeping the room light, preventing it from feeling cramped.
Additionally, the interplay between carpet color and wall color is essential. In larger areas, bold contrasts can work well, while in smaller spaces, choosing shades within the same family can create a seamless transition, enhancing the overall flow of the room.

What Maintenance Practices Are Best for Neutral Carpets?
Maintaining neutral carpets requires specific practices to preserve their appearance and longevity.
- Regular Vacuuming: Frequent vacuuming is essential to remove dirt and debris that can accumulate on the carpet’s surface. This practice helps prevent fiber damage and keeps the carpet looking fresh, especially important for lighter neutral shades that can show dirt more readily.
- Spot Cleaning: Addressing spills and stains immediately with appropriate cleaners is crucial for maintaining a neutral carpet. Using a gentle, pH-balanced cleaner helps to prevent discoloration while ensuring that the carpet fibers are not damaged in the process.
- Deep Cleaning: Periodic deep cleaning, whether through professional services or DIY methods, is necessary to remove embedded dirt and allergens. This process typically involves hot water extraction or steam cleaning, which can revitalize the carpet’s appearance and extend its lifespan.
- Use of Area Rugs: Placing area rugs in high traffic areas can protect neutral carpets from excessive wear and staining. These rugs can absorb dirt and moisture, making it easier to maintain the overall cleanliness of the carpet beneath.
- Proper Furniture Placement: Arranging furniture to minimize direct contact with the carpet can prevent indentations and wear patterns. Additionally, using coasters or protective pads under furniture legs can help support the carpet’s integrity over time.
- Humidity Control: Maintaining appropriate humidity levels in your home can help prevent mold and mildew growth, which can discolor and damage neutral carpets. Using dehumidifiers in damp areas or ensuring good ventilation can contribute to a healthier carpet environment.
